What Is a Trailer Axle Drum Brake?
A trailer axle drum brake is a mechanical or pneumatic braking system where friction is created inside a rotating drum attached to the wheel hub. When the brakes are applied, brake shoes press outward against the inner surface of the drum, converting kinetic energy into heat and slowing the rotation of the wheel.
Drum brakes are commonly used on trailer axles because they provide consistent braking force under heavy loads and are well-suited for both electric and air brake systems.
Main Components of a Trailer Drum Brake System
Understanding the components helps explain why drum brakes are so robust and dependable:
- Brake Drum
Mounted to the wheel hub, the drum rotates with the wheel. Its inner surface provides the friction area for braking. - Brake Shoes
Curved metal shoes lined with friction material. When activated, they expand outward to contact the drum. - Actuation Mechanism
- Electric brakes: Use an electromagnet to pull the actuating arm, forcing the shoes outward.
- Air brakes: Use an air chamber and pushrod to rotate a camshaft (S-cam), spreading the shoes.
- Return Springs
Pull the brake shoes back into their resting position when braking force is released. - Backing Plate
A rigid plate mounted to the axle that supports and aligns all brake components.
How Trailer Axle Drum Brakes Work
When the driver applies the brakes:
- A signal (electric current or compressed air) is sent to the trailer’s brake system.
- The actuator forces the brake shoes outward.
- The shoes press against the inner surface of the rotating drum.
- Friction slows the wheel, reducing the trailer’s speed.
Once the braking force is released, the return springs retract the shoes, allowing the drum to rotate freely again.
Advantages of Drum Brakes on Trailer Axles
Trailer drum brakes continue to be popular for several reasons:
- High Load Capacity: Drum brakes handle heavy trailer weights effectively.
- Cost-Effective: Generally less expensive than disc brake systems.
- Long Service Life: Enclosed design protects components from debris and weather.
- Strong Holding Power: Particularly effective for parking and stationary braking.
- Compatibility: Easily integrated with electric and air brake systems.
Limitations and Considerations
Despite their advantages, drum brakes are not without drawbacks:
- Heat Dissipation: Drum brakes retain heat more than disc brakes, which can lead to brake fade under repeated heavy braking.
- Maintenance Complexity: More internal components mean inspections and repairs can take longer.
- Weight: Drum brake assemblies are typically heavier than disc brake alternatives.
For applications involving frequent stops, steep descents, or high-speed operation, disc brakes may be considered as an alternative.
Maintenance Tips for Trailer Drum Brakes
Proper maintenance is critical for safety and performance:
- Regular Inspections: Check brake shoes, drums, and springs for wear or damage.
- Adjust Brakes Properly: Incorrect shoe-to-drum clearance can reduce braking efficiency.
- Monitor Drum Condition: Look for cracks, excessive wear, or heat spots.
- Keep Components Clean: Remove dust and debris during servicing to prevent uneven wear.
- Replace in Sets: For balanced braking, replace shoes and hardware on both sides of the axle.
Following manufacturer service intervals and torque specifications is essential for reliable operation.
Applications of Trailer Axle Drum Brakes
Drum brakes are commonly found on:
- Commercial freight trailers
- Agricultural trailers
- Utility and equipment trailers
- Boat trailers (with corrosion-resistant designs)
- Light and medium-duty transport trailers
Their versatility makes them suitable for both on-road and off-road use.
